Empire Commuter: Amtrak loses free speech suit

Amtrak's thin-skinned attitude leads to this type of sordid and slightly ridiculous scenario in which a Green Party activist is roughed up and arrested for the crime of being an embarrassment at a publicity event:

DEBBY HANRAHAN WINS SETTLEMENT IN FIRST AMENDMENT-FALSE ARREST LAWSUIT AGAINST AMTRAK

"I was attending a public rally in about as public a place as you can imagine, to which members of the public were invited through radio and newspaper announcements, and which featured on the stage Mayor Williams and several members of the D.C. Council and Sports and Entertainment Commission. My 'crime' was being out of sync with the message of the rally, and for that I was given no warning and was grabbed in a painful shoulder hold by an Amtrak policeman, pulled out of the rally, arrested, charged with trespassing, incarcerated for 28 hours, and required to give a urine sample in the presence of both male and female court and U.S. Marshal personnel. "
